*** testy has quit IRC | 00:46 | |
*** slaf has quit IRC | 06:55 | |
*** slaf has joined #buildstream | 06:59 | |
*** slaf has joined #buildstream | 06:59 | |
*** slaf has joined #buildstream | 06:59 | |
*** slaf has joined #buildstream | 06:59 | |
*** slaf has joined #buildstream | 07:00 | |
*** slaf has joined #buildstream | 07:00 | |
*** slaf has joined #buildstream | 07:00 | |
*** slaf has joined #buildstream | 07:00 | |
*** slaf has joined #buildstream | 07:01 | |
*** slaf has joined #buildstream | 07:01 | |
*** slaf has joined #buildstream | 07:01 | |
coldtom | does anyone know if bb-storage is compatible with buildstream for an artifact cache? | 08:41 |
---|---|---|
*** rdale has joined #buildstream | 09:33 | |
*** santi has joined #buildstream | 09:38 | |
*** traveltissues has joined #buildstream | 09:42 | |
benschubert | tpollard: the status bar is meant to be displayed on your branch rigth? | 09:55 |
benschubert | Because my terminal apparently isn't showing that :( | 09:55 |
tpollard | benschubert: works for me :/ what if you try one of the doc examples, like autotools? | 09:56 |
tpollard | it renders slightly differently on purpose, but it should work | 09:58 |
benschubert | autotools won't build, I don't get a sandbox on wsl :) | 09:59 |
*** phildawson has joined #buildstream | 10:00 | |
gitlab-br-bot | traveltissues opened MR !1707 (traveltissues/1204->master: app: Pass color setting to Status)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1707 | 10:19 |
traveltissues | tpollard, ^ | 10:20 |
*** phildawson has quit IRC | 10:22 | |
*** phildawson has joined #buildstream | 10:22 | |
*** phildawson_ has joined #buildstream | 10:25 | |
*** phildawson has quit IRC | 10:27 | |
*** jonathanmaw has joined #buildstream | 10:32 | |
*** lachlan has joined #buildstream | 10:36 | |
gitlab-br-bot | cs-shadow approved MR !1707 (traveltissues/1204->master: app: Pass color setting to Status)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1707 | 10:43 |
tpollard | I don't think we should merge that traveltissues ^ | 10:49 |
traveltissues | right | 10:53 |
traveltissues | we don't need that attribute | 10:53 |
tpollard | just dropping ._colors from Status should do it | 10:54 |
traveltissues | yes | 10:54 |
traveltissues | either works but removing that is better | 10:55 |
tpollard | I'm not sure I like overriding clicks autodetection globally with its context, but it's probably a non issue | 10:57 |
traveltissues | right, this is not the fix i'd eventually like, but it's just the minimal one on top of the change that went in | 10:58 |
tpollard | yep | 11:00 |
tpollard | thanks for looking at the issue, I got sucked into something else yesterday before leaving | 11:01 |
tlater[m] | benschubert: If you get some time, mind having a look at !1645 again? Not much has changed code-wise, though I've responded to a couple of your comments. | 11:01 |
gitlab-br-bot | MR !1645: WIP: Refactor casserver.py: Stop relying on the buildstream-internal `CASCache` implementation https://gitlab.com/BuildStream/buildstream/merge_requests/1645 | 11:01 |
gitlab-br-bot | tpollard approved MR !1707 (traveltissues/1204->master: app: Pass color setting to Status)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1707 | 11:01 |
tlater[m] | I'll probably add in-code comments once we're through with the discussion instead of leaving things as-is, but I don't think I want to make code changes atm. | 11:01 |
benschubert | tlater[m]: did I? Or do you mean the update_State MR? | 11:02 |
tlater[m] | benschubert: Update state, yeah | 11:02 |
tlater[m] | Hehe | 11:02 |
tlater[m] | Wrong mr | 11:02 |
tlater[m] | Should be !660 | 11:02 |
gitlab-br-bot | MR !660: CAS: Fix resource_name format for blobs https://gitlab.com/BuildStream/buildstream/merge_requests/660 | 11:02 |
tlater[m] | Argh | 11:02 |
tlater[m] | !1660 | 11:03 |
gitlab-br-bot | MR !1660: Remove update_state https://gitlab.com/BuildStream/buildstream/merge_requests/1660 | 11:03 |
*** cs-shadow has joined #buildstream | 11:03 | |
* tlater[m] thinks he's not entirely awake yet | 11:03 | |
benschubert | sure I'll have a look | 11:03 |
*** lachlan has quit IRC | 11:05 | |
*** lachlan has joined #buildstream | 11:05 | |
*** lachlan has quit IRC | 11:16 | |
*** lachlan has joined #buildstream | 11:19 | |
*** lachlan has quit IRC | 11:32 | |
*** lachlan has joined #buildstream | 11:43 | |
jjardon | coldtom: it should work: see https://gitlab.com/BuildStream/buildstream/issues/1050 if not please open a new issue | 11:45 |
*** lachlan has quit IRC | 11:55 | |
*** lachlan has joined #buildstream | 12:06 | |
*** brlogger has joined #buildstream | 12:12 | |
gitlab-br-bot | marge-bot123 closed issue #1204 (Colourisation lost in Status Widget UI) on buildstream https://gitlab.com/BuildStream/buildstream/issues/1204 | 12:28 |
gitlab-br-bot | marge-bot123 merged MR !1707 (traveltissues/1204->master: app: Pass color setting to Status)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1707 | 12:28 |
cs-shadow | hi, would anyone like to have another look at https://gitlab.com/BuildStream/buildstream/merge_requests/1703 ? | 13:03 |
cs-shadow | it's the black reformatting MR | 13:04 |
* tlater[m] is looking forward to that landing :D | 13:04 | |
*** santi has quit IRC | 13:19 | |
gitlab-br-bot | cs-shadow opened issue #1206 (Pylint configuratin is busted) on buildstream https://gitlab.com/BuildStream/buildstream/issues/1206 | 13:23 |
gitlab-br-bot | traveltissues approved MR !1692 (bschubert/graceful-children-sigterm->master: Gracefully shutdown children on termination)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1692 | 13:23 |
cs-shadow | tlater[m]: you may be interested in ^^ | 13:24 |
cs-shadow | that would also explain why we were confused on the flake8 mr about pylint not reporting those errors | 13:24 |
tlater[m] | cs-shadow: Ah, that makes a lot of sense | 13:27 |
tlater[m] | Yeah, pylint is module based, to the confusion of anyone who's ever tried to set it up | 13:27 |
tlater[m] | It won't like file paths like that | 13:27 |
cs-shadow | 6 months no pylint, only 15 regressions, not too bad :) | 13:28 |
benschubert | tpollard: would you mind testing !1692 since you opened the issue? :) | 13:41 |
tpollard | yep, on my list for today | 13:42 |
gitlab-br-bot | cs-shadow opened MR !1708 (chandan/pylint->master: Fix pylint configuration)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1708 | 13:45 |
gitlab-br-bot | traveltissues approved MR !1708 (chandan/pylint->master: Fix pylint configuration)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1708 | 13:58 |
gitlab-br-bot | tlater approved MR !1708 (chandan/pylint->master: Fix pylint configuration)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1708 | 14:18 |
*** santi has joined #buildstream | 14:21 | |
*** akvilebirgelyte_ has joined #buildstream | 14:57 | |
gitlab-br-bot | marge-bot123 closed issue #1206 (Pylint configuration is busted) on buildstream https://gitlab.com/BuildStream/buildstream/issues/1206 | 15:11 |
gitlab-br-bot | marge-bot123 merged MR !1708 (chandan/pylint->master: Fix pylint configuration)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1708 | 15:11 |
*** phoenix has joined #buildstream | 15:20 | |
*** rdale has quit IRC | 15:23 | |
*** rdale has joined #buildstream | 15:24 | |
*** phoenix has quit IRC | 15:26 | |
*** lachlan has quit IRC | 15:29 | |
gitlab-br-bot | tlater approved MR !1703 (chandan/black->master: Use Black to format code)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1703 | 15:32 |
*** santi has quit IRC | 15:42 | |
*** jonathanmaw has quit IRC | 15:51 | |
*** jonathanmaw has joined #buildstream | 15:52 | |
tlater[m] | cs-shadow: Your build --track removal MR didn't remove the options from, say, fetch | 15:54 |
tlater[m] | Was that intentional? | 15:55 |
* tlater[m] doesn't think we can simplify things much if fetch is still able to build a pipeline that also needs to track | 15:55 | |
cs-shadow | Intentional, yes | 15:56 |
cs-shadow | Desirable, maybe no | 15:56 |
*** bochecha_ has joined #buildstream | 15:56 | |
cs-shadow | We also need to consider workspace open —track | 15:56 |
*** bochecha has quit IRC | 15:56 | |
traveltissues | also #1193 | 15:56 |
gitlab-br-bot | Issue #1193: Split `Stream._load` for target types https://gitlab.com/BuildStream/buildstream/issues/1193 | 15:56 |
*** bochecha_ is now known as bochecha | 15:57 | |
cs-shadow | My stance is that we should probably still support those two cases, but as syntactic sugar. And without needing to do them in a single pipeline | 15:57 |
tlater[m] | traveltissues: I'm... actually working on that right now | 15:57 |
cs-shadow | But maybe we need to discus that on the list as well | 15:58 |
tpollard | benschubert: WFM :) | 15:58 |
tlater[m] | cs-shadow: That's going to be hairy code wise, and I'm not sure it's really beneficial | 15:58 |
benschubert | tpollard: o/ let's send that to marge then | 15:58 |
tpollard | \o/ | 15:59 |
tlater[m] | If we're disallowing `bst build --track` because we don't think it's worth the maintenance effort, why whould we allow `bst fetch --track`? It's just UI inconsistency. | 15:59 |
*** traveltissues has quit IRC | 16:00 | |
cs-shadow | personally I’ll be very happy to drop them. I was just saying that if we do support them, we should at least simplify the code such that track and everything else don’t need to happen in the same pipeline | 16:00 |
tlater[m] | Ah, right, I see what you mean | 16:01 |
* tlater[m] thinks he'll start a ML discussion on the topic, then | 16:01 | |
cs-shadow | That’ll be useful | 16:02 |
benschubert | tpollard: wsl vs windows fs doesn't change much from my current tests, I'm now running the profiles :) | 16:02 |
gitlab-br-bot | frazerleslieclews opened (was WIP) MR !1693 (frazer/flake8->chandan/black: flake8)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1693 | 16:15 |
tpollard | benschubert: :/ well at least that can be ruled out I guess | 16:16 |
* tpollard thinks we should implement a render limiter to the frontend, like we have for the task reporting | 16:18 | |
tpollard | we have a minimum refresh rate, I also think as a human have a upper limit also makes sense | 16:18 |
*** traveltissues has joined #buildstream | 16:19 | |
benschubert | YES YES PLEASE! | 16:21 |
benschubert | sorry :) | 16:21 |
benschubert | but more than every .5 sec makes it useless | 16:21 |
benschubert | I am happy not to be epileptic those days, wathcing big builds | 16:21 |
tpollard | xD | 16:22 |
tpollard | bst disco | 16:22 |
*** traveltissues has quit IRC | 16:23 | |
tlater[m] | hah | 16:23 |
tlater[m] | Increases refresh rate to once every .1s! | 16:24 |
tpollard | pretty sure the debian build causes a higher rate than that for me | 16:24 |
* tlater[m] wonders if we could do some smart ncurses only-update-what-needs-to-be thing | 16:25 | |
tlater[m] | But I suppose with the scrolling log it's not that easy | 16:25 |
benschubert | click does use curses, so i hope it's smart-ish :) | 16:27 |
tlater[m] | benschubert: iirc it takes a bit more effort to get it to be really smart (otherwise you get flickering like we do) | 16:29 |
gitlab-br-bot | marge-bot123 closed issue #1185 (bst build does not exit gracefully on a second CTRL-C) on buildstream https://gitlab.com/BuildStream/buildstream/issues/1185 | 16:39 |
gitlab-br-bot | marge-bot123 closed issue #1185 (bst build does not exit gracefully on a second CTRL-C) on buildstream https://gitlab.com/BuildStream/buildstream/issues/1185 | 16:39 |
gitlab-br-bot | marge-bot123 merged MR !1692 (bschubert/graceful-children-sigterm->master: Gracefully shutdown children on termination) on buildstream https://gitlab.com/BuildStream/buildstream/merge_requests/1692 | 16:39 |
tpollard | woop | 16:39 |
* coldtom mashes CTRL-C to celebrate | 16:40 | |
benschubert | o/that was an ugly one | 16:43 |
*** santi has joined #buildstream | 16:57 | |
tpollard | benschubert: works in my branch after rebasing too, now to see if I can drop a signal.set_wakeup_fd I had to add.... | 17:18 |
*** lachlan has joined #buildstream | 17:20 | |
*** narispo has quit IRC | 17:45 | |
*** narispo has joined #buildstream | 17:46 | |
*** bochecha has quit IRC | 17:48 | |
*** santi has quit IRC | 17:50 | |
*** lachlan has quit IRC | 17:52 | |
*** narispo has quit IRC | 18:04 | |
*** lachlan has joined #buildstream | 18:10 | |
*** tiagogomes has quit IRC | 18:17 | |
*** paulsherwood has quit IRC | 18:18 | |
benschubert | oh nice :) | 18:18 |
*** qinusty has quit IRC | 18:19 | |
*** paulsherwood has joined #buildstream | 18:19 | |
*** ikerperez has quit IRC | 18:19 | |
*** adds68 has quit IRC | 18:19 | |
*** bethw has quit IRC | 18:21 | |
*** laurence has quit IRC | 18:22 | |
*** valentind has quit IRC | 18:22 | |
*** valentind has joined #buildstream | 18:22 | |
*** WSalmon has quit IRC | 18:22 | |
*** WSalmon has joined #buildstream | 18:22 | |
*** paulsherwood has quit IRC | 18:23 | |
*** phildawson_ has quit IRC | 18:26 | |
*** laurence has joined #buildstream | 18:27 | |
*** bethw has joined #buildstream | 18:27 | |
*** narispo has joined #buildstream | 18:28 | |
*** valentind has quit IRC | 18:39 | |
*** laurence has quit IRC | 18:39 | |
*** jward has quit IRC | 18:39 | |
*** bethw has quit IRC | 18:39 | |
*** WSalmon has quit IRC | 18:39 | |
*** narispo has quit IRC | 18:39 | |
*** bethw has joined #buildstream | 18:39 | |
*** jward has joined #buildstream | 18:40 | |
*** jward has joined #buildstream | 18:42 | |
*** valentind has joined #buildstream | 18:43 | |
*** laurence has joined #buildstream | 18:43 | |
*** jward has joined #buildstream | 18:44 | |
*** WSalmon has joined #buildstream | 18:44 | |
*** lachlan has quit IRC | 18:54 | |
*** jonathanmaw has quit IRC | 19:00 | |
*** adds68 has joined #buildstream | 19:33 | |
*** cs-shadow has quit IRC | 20:23 | |
*** lachlan has joined #buildstream | 20:46 | |
*** lachlan has quit IRC | 21:46 | |
*** narispo has joined #buildstream | 21:48 | |
*** bochecha has joined #buildstream | 21:55 | |
*** narispo has quit IRC | 22:01 | |
*** narispo has joined #buildstream | 22:04 | |
*** narispo has quit IRC | 22:11 | |
*** narispo has joined #buildstream | 22:12 | |
*** narispo has quit IRC | 22:16 | |
*** narispo has joined #buildstream | 22:18 | |
*** narispo has quit IRC | 22:51 | |
*** narispo has joined #buildstream | 22:55 | |
*** narispo has joined #buildstream | 22:56 | |
*** paulsherwood has joined #buildstream | 23:22 |
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!